Hello!

Looking to speed up my render process. I have 5 sequences, some of which have duplicate files. I'd like to put all the timelines in one sequence and do a duplicate detection so it doesn't rerender a clip again. Is there a way for Resolve to do this?

Under the " Clips" tab you will find a filter labeled " Common Media Pool Source" This will filter all files that are selected with the same name and location on your Drive in your current timeline.
